8 alternativas de AG Grid para sus aplicaciones Angular, React y Web Components
AG Grid es una de las cuadrículas de datos JavaScript más populares y ricas en funciones disponibles en la actualidad. Pero, ¿existen alternativas a la red AG? Sí. Descúbrelos aquí.
¿AG Grid sigue siendo la mejor opción para crear tablas de datos complejas en aplicaciones web modernas? Como una de las cuadrículas de datos de JavaScript más conocidas y ricas en funciones, AG Grid ha sido durante mucho tiempo una solución de referencia para los desarrolladores que trabajan con Angular, React y otros marcos populares. Sin embargo, a medida que el ecosistema front-end continúa evolucionando, muchos equipos están comenzando a explorar otras opciones más eficientes, rentables y flexibles para su caso de uso específico.
Sin embargo, con un número creciente de bibliotecas disponibles en el mercado hoy en día, cada una de las cuales ofrece sus propias fortalezas y compensaciones, seleccionar la cuadrícula adecuada podría ser un desafío. Dado que puede afectar significativamente tanto la experiencia del desarrollador como el rendimiento de la aplicación, este artículo explorará algunos de los principales contendientes para facilitar su elección. Estos incluirán AG Grid y las alternativas emergentes de AG Grid. La publicación del blog también describirá para qué es más adecuado cada uno, junto con las limitaciones que debe considerar.
Empecemos.
| Solución de red | Mejor para | Características clave | Advantages | Soporte de marco | Limitaciones |
|---|---|---|---|---|---|
| Mesa de mano | Aplicaciones similares a hojas de cálculo, interfaces de usuario financieras/científicas/con muchos datos | Ordenación, filtrado, autocompletar, enlace de datos, cambio de tamaño de filas y columnas, resumen de columnas, validación de datos | Soporte de complementos, API fácil de usar, fácil personalización | React, Angular, Vue | Problemas de rendimiento, documentación limitada, pesado para un uso sencillo |
| Ignite UI | Aplicaciones de nivel empresarial con todas las funciones, escenarios con muchos datos | Edición por lotes, filtrado avanzado, persistencia de estado, virtualización, navegación por teclado y otros | Construido para velocidad, funcionalidad y alto rendimiento, motor de cuadrícula rápido, personalización profunda, gráficos, soporte entre marcos + un control de cuadrícula pivotante separado | Todos los marcos modernos | Se requiere una licencia comercial para el acceso completo después de que expire la prueba gratuita |
| Cuadrícula de datos MUI X | Proyectos de interfaz de usuario de materiales, aplicaciones de React de tamaño mediano | Virtualización de columnas, Datos de árbol, Pivotación, Reordenación de filas, Asistente de IA, Filtro rápido | Se integra con Material UI, modelo de núcleo abierto, intuitivo para desarrolladores React | React | React funciones avanzadas cerradas detrás de niveles pagos |
| Kendo UI | Aplicaciones empresariales | Agrupación, Exportación, Jerarquía, Columnas fijas, Virtualización, Ordenación, Accesibilidad | Conjunto de componentes sólido, interfaz de usuario pulida, centrado en la empresa | Angular, React, Vue, jQuery | Curva de aprendizaje pronunciada, licencia comercial, gran tamaño de paquete |
| DevExtreme | Cuadrículas empresariales, aplicaciones web de alto rendimiento | Detalle maestro, desplazamiento virtual, exportación, actualizaciones en vivo, filtrado, paginación, agrupación de registros | Kit de herramientas flexible, diseño receptivo, bien documentado | Angular, React, Vue, jQuery | Costos de licencia, pesados para uso básico, estilo complejo |
| Syncfusion | Aplicaciones empresariales ricas en datos y móviles | Ordenación, Filtrado, Edición, Modos de selección, Personalizaciones de columnas, Resúmenes de datos, Exportación | Carga rápida de datos, amplias opciones de visualización de datos | Angular, React, Vue, Blazor y más | Se necesita licencia comercial, interfaz de usuario obsoleta en partes, enfoque de ventas agresivo |
| Cuadrícula de ApexCharts | Necesidades de tablas sencillas con gráficos | Ordenación, filtrado, paginación, virtualización de nivel de fila, cambio de tamaño de columna, tipos de columna automáticos | Ligero, de código abierto y fácil integración | Todos los frameworks de JS | Funciones limitadas, no apto para aplicaciones grandes, comunidad más pequeña |
| App Builder | Desarrollo rápido de bajo código, automatización, GenAI | WYSIWYG arrastrar y soltar, CRUD, enlace de API en tiempo real, GenAI, generación de código, Swagger | La generación de código, Figma a código, interfaz de usuario visual, acelera el desarrollo en un 80% | Angular, React, Web Components, Blazor | Requiere licencia posterior a la prueba, limitada a marcos seleccionados |
Las mejores alternativas de AG Grid: descripción general
Hay otras soluciones que abren nuevos caminos, ofreciendo mucho más en términos de características personalizadas, integraciones perfectas y rentabilidad. Entonces, ¿cuáles son exactamente las alternativas de AG Grid que existen?

Mesa de mano
Esta es una popular cuadrícula de datos de JavaScript que combina una interfaz de usuario de hoja de cálculo. La gente generalmente lo usa por su capacidad para manejar grandes volúmenes de datos, pero las reseñas en Reddit indican que muestra algunos problemas de rendimiento y carece de documentación extensa.
¿Cuáles son las ventajas?
- Fácil de usar, personalizar y ampliar con complementos personalizados.
- Funciona con React, Angular y Vue.
- Experiencia similar a Excel al trabajar con él y funciones como clasificación, filtrado, relleno automático, enlace de datos, cambio de tamaño de filas y columnas, resumen de columnas, validación de datos y otras.
- Una API fácil de usar para desarrolladores.
- Proporciona tutoriales útiles y tiene soporte comunitario + comercial.
¿Cuáles son las limitaciones?
- Problemas de rendimiento informados.
- No hay documentación extensa.
- Pesado para mesas simples.
Ideal para: Aplicaciones similares a Excel y centradas en hojas de cálculo, interfaces de cuadrícula financieras, científicas o con muchos datos, casos de uso que requieren edición y fórmulas en tiempo real.
Ignite UI
El Ignite UI Grid está diseñado para aplicaciones ricas en datos y está diseñado para manejar millones de registros y actualizaciones en tiempo real sin ningún problema de rendimiento. Esto lo convierte en una de las mejores opciones entre otras alternativas de AG Grid.

¿Cuáles son los beneficios?
- Motor de cuadrícula súper rápido que puede manejar filas y columnas ilimitadas de datos al instante.
- Acceso a plantillas personalizadas y actualizaciones de datos en tiempo real.
- Conjunto de características avanzadas de cuadrícula de datos para cualquier escenario, como edición por lotes, filtrado avanzado, persistencia de estado, virtualización, navegación por teclado y otras.
- API intuitiva para la creación de temas y la marca más sencillas.
- Data binding with minimal hand-coding.
- Gráficos de alto rendimiento que pueden representar millones de puntos de datos sin interrupciones.
- Integración perfecta con todos los marcos.
- Un cambio continuo entre Angular, Blazor, Web Components o React.
- Diseño móvil, versatilidad y máximo rendimiento en cualquier navegador moderno.
- Capacidad para ser más ágil ante los requisitos cambiantes en un marco determinado.
- Toneladas de opciones de personalización y un tiempo de carga inigualable.
- Rápido e interactivo 60+ tablas y gráficos.
- Una comunidad vibrante y apoyo.
- Un control de cuadrícula de pivote independiente.
¿Cuáles son las limitaciones?
- Se requiere licencia comercial para el acceso completo.
- Puede ser demasiado avanzado para casos de uso simples.
- Curva de aprendizaje para desarrolladores no empresariales.
Ideal para: aplicaciones empresariales de alto rendimiento y ricas en datos; paneles complejos en tiempo real en Angular, React o cualquier otra tecnología; desarrolladores que necesitan funciones avanzadas de cuadrícula en todos los marcos; soporte confiable a largo plazo y documentación extensa; muestras de cuadrícula para comenzar, etc.
Si lo desea, puede comparar rápidamente Ignite UI for Angular con otros proveedores para ver todas las ventajas de un vistazo.
Cuadrícula de datos MUI X
MUI X Data Grid es un componente basado en TypeScript que se utiliza para mostrar datos en un formato estructurado de filas y columnas. Aunque es popular entre los desarrolladores, se limita a React.
¿Cuáles son los beneficios?
- API intuitiva para implementar casos de uso complejos.
- Puede manejar conjuntos ilimitados de datos.
- Las funciones de tematización están diseñadas para ser fluidas cuando se integran con Material UI y otros componentes de MUI X.
- Es de núcleo abierto.
- Empaqueta funciones como edición en línea, agrupación de columnas, filtro rápido, virtualización de columnas, paneles de filas maestro-detalle, carga diferida, datos de árbol, pivote, asistente de IA, reordenación de filas y otras.
¿Cuáles son las limitaciones?
- Disponible solo para React.
- La versión comunitaria tiene licencia MIT y es gratuita, pero las funciones más avanzadas están bloqueadas y requieren una licencia comercial Pro o Premium.
Ideal para: aplicaciones que ya usan Material UI; aplicaciones React de tamaño mediano que necesitan funcionalidad de tabla estándar; desarrolladores que buscan una interfaz de usuario consistente con Material Design, equipos conscientes del presupuesto (gratis para pequeñas empresas e individuos).
Interfaz de usuario de Kendo
Kendo UI JavaScript Data Grid es una de las mejores opciones entre los desarrolladores, y la razón de esto es la cantidad de funciones de cuadrícula básicas y avanzadas, además de la promesa de un alto rendimiento.
¿Cuáles son las ventajas?
- Rico en funciones como edición, filtrado, agrupación, exportación, virtualización, clasificación, filas y columnas fijas, jerarquía y más.
- Amplio conjunto de componentes adicionales de la interfaz de usuario.
- Fuerte apoyo a la accesibilidad y la globalización.
- Rejillas de alto rendimiento.
- Documentación completa y una sólida comunidad de desarrollo.
¿Cuáles son las limitaciones?
- Complejo de usar con una curva de aprendizaje pronunciada.
- Se requiere licencia comercial para el acceso completo.
- El tamaño del paquete puede ser grande según el uso.
- El estilo personalizado puede requerir esfuerzo y experiencia adicionales.
Ideal para: desarrolladores más experimentados que están ansiosos por superar la curva de aprendizaje; aplicaciones empresariales que necesitan una interfaz de usuario pulida y lista para usar; equipos que utilizan el ecosistema de Telerik para mantener la coherencia; desarrollo entre marcos (Angular, React, Vue, jQuery)
DevExtreme
Conocido por las cuadrículas receptivas y la velocidad, DevExtreme proporciona la mayoría de las funciones que necesitará el 99% de los desarrolladores. Existe un conjunto de herramientas potente y flexible para crear aplicaciones web de alto rendimiento y ricas en funciones en múltiples marcos, incluidos Angular, React, Vue y jQuery.
¿Cuáles son las ventajas?
- Admite escenarios avanzados como Maestro-Detalle, Desplazamiento virtual, Actualizaciones en vivo, Exportación a Excel/PDF y funciones como Filtrado de datos, Paginación, Ordenación, Agrupación de registros y Cálculos de resumen.
- Amplias opciones de personalización.
- Buena documentación.
¿Cuáles son las limitaciones?
- Costos de licencia para funciones completas.
- Puede sentirse más pesado para casos de uso mínimos.
- El estilo y la personalización del tema pueden ser complejos.
Ideal para: interfaces de gestión de datos de nivel empresarial;
Fusión de sincronía
Syncfusion ofrece una cuadrícula de datos de JavaScript completa que forma parte de un conjunto más amplio de componentes de interfaz de usuario diseñados para aplicaciones de nivel empresarial. Conocido por su capacidad para manejar grandes volúmenes de datos de manera eficiente, Syncfusion se destaca por su sólido rendimiento, amplio conjunto de funciones y soporte en múltiples marcos modernos.
¿Cuáles son las ventajas?
- Puede cargar grandes cantidades de datos rápidamente.
- Con un diseño mobile-first que se adapta a cualquier resolución.
- Disponible para Angular, React, Vue, Blazor y más.
- Modos flexibles de edición y selección de registros.
- Varias personalizaciones de columnas y resúmenes de datos.
- Opciones de exportación de datos como PDF, CSV y Excel.
¿Cuáles son las limitaciones?
- Se necesita licencia comercial para uso comercial / equipo completo.
- Es posible que el estilo de la interfaz de usuario no sea tan moderno como Material o las bibliotecas personalizadas.
- Curva de aprendizaje ligeramente más pronunciada debido a la variedad de funciones y personalizaciones.
- Fuerza de ventas agresiva.
- Una licencia gratuita que podría ser muy limitada en términos de características y capacidades de desarrollo.
- La localización requiere esfuerzo y tiempo adicionales para que funcione correctamente.
- Claves bloqueadas por versiones.
Ideal para: desarrolladores que necesitan un conjunto completo de controles con una sólida visualización de datos y aplicaciones empresariales con grandes necesidades de personalización.
Gráficos de Apex
ApexCharts es una popular biblioteca de gráficos de código abierto que ayuda a los desarrolladores a crear hermosos e interactivos
Enumeramos esto entre las mejores alternativas de AG Grid, ya que es una cuadrícula de datos JavaScript gratuita con todas las características principales que necesitan los desarrolladores.
¿Cuáles son las ventajas?
- Tipos de columna que se generan automáticamente en función de la fuente de datos, etc.
- Tiene documentación bien escrita.
- La cuadrícula es liviana y proporciona características básicas como ordenación, filtrado, paginación, virtualización a nivel de fila, cambio de tamaño de columna, tipos de columna automáticos y otras.
- Se puede integrar fácilmente, diseñado para funcionar en cualquier marco, en cualquier plataforma.
- Uso gratuito y de código abierto.
¿Cuáles son las limitaciones?
- El conjunto de características no es tan extenso como en otras cuadrículas.
- Todavía madurando con menos recursos comunitarios.
- No es la opción óptima para aplicaciones complejas a gran escala.
Ideal para: proyectos ligeros que necesitan funcionalidad básica de tabla, desarrolladores que ya usan ApexCharts para la visualización.
™ App Builder
App Builder es una herramienta de bajo código que tiene componentes Grid, que pueden servir como otra alternativa a AG Grid, ofreciendo varias ventajas en términos de velocidad, simplicidad, funcionalidad y personalización.
¿Cuáles son los beneficios?
- Generación y vista previa de código para Angular, React, Web Components y Blazor.
- Diseñado para acelerar el desarrollo de aplicaciones al abstraer gran parte de la codificación manual propensa a errores.
- Tiene interfaces de desarrollo visual y componentes de interfaz de usuario preconstruidos e independientes del marco, lo que reduce el tiempo de desarrollo en un 80%.
- Funcionalidad GenAI para la generación de fuentes de datos, imágenes y vistas.
- Se centra en la simplicidad y la facilidad de uso para que los desarrolladores con diferentes niveles de experiencia puedan aprovechar el poder de App Builder.
- Con funcionalidades de cuadrícula listas para usar y las características más demandadas, incluidos los componentes de visualización de datos.
- La simplicidad es clave a la hora de configurar una cuadrícula de datos con todas las funciones de UX necesarias para los clientes.
- Con API abierta (soporte de Swagger) y acciones CRUD completas de Grid (Crear, Leer, Actualizar y Eliminar).
- Actualizaciones de API web en tiempo real y generación de código en un clic.
- Es muy fácil crear aplicaciones desde cero, comenzar con aplicaciones de muestra o convertir diseños de Figma en código.
- Prueba gratuita.
¿Cuáles son las limitaciones?
- Requiere una licencia después de que expire la prueba gratuita.
- Limitado a Angular, React, Web Components y Blazor.
Ideal para: desarrollo de aplicaciones de bajo código, reducción de los esfuerzos de codificación manual, aplicaciones de nivel empresarial, que requieren cuadrículas de alto rendimiento, equipos que desean automatizar tareas repetitivas y mundanas, usar IA + código bajo para una creación de aplicaciones web aún más rápida, desarrolladores ciudadanos y programadores con conocimientos limitados.

Resumen y Reflexiones Finales...
A medida que navegamos por las opciones y varias alternativas de AG Grid para aplicaciones de Angular y React disponibles en la actualidad, se hace evidente que una búsqueda constante de innovación y optimización marca el mundo del desarrollo front-end. Cada alternativa a AG Grid intenta abordar las necesidades cambiantes de los desarrolladores y la naturaleza diversa de los proyectos que emprenden, solo para ofrecer mejores soluciones basadas en datos.
Si bien el número de competidores de AG Grid está creciendo, el proceso de toma de decisiones requiere un enfoque informado. Es por eso que factores críticos como la calidad del código fuente, la confiabilidad, la facilidad de uso, el rendimiento, las características de la cuadrícula de datos, la documentación y el soporte de la comunidad juegan un papel fundamental para guiar a los desarrolladores hacia la selección de la herramienta más adecuada para su caso de uso específico.